I must say after reading it that I agree with this Catie lady on almost everything. I like LTROI movie better than the book (which is quite good indeed) and I totally love Cloe Moretz in her role as Abby, but Lina/Eli is something else... She is the heart of the film, no doubt about that.
LMI is (much) more explicit in certain scenes, especially in the violent ones, while LTROI has some kind of sensitivity even when something awful happens. That works better for me.
